FAQ

What can I expect from the 1-day pottery workshop?

Our 1-day workshop is designed for beginners and enthusiasts looking to try pottery for the first time. During the session, you will learn basic pottery techniques, including wheel throwing and hand-building, guided by our experienced instructors. By the end, you’ll create your own piece of pottery to be glazed and fired.

Do I need any prior experience?

No prior experience is necessary! Our workshop is beginner-friendly, and we’ll provide all the guidance you need to make your pottery piece.

How long is the workshop?

The workshop typically lasts 2-3 hours, depending on the size of the group and the techniques covered.

What is included in the workshop fee?

The fee covers:

  • All materials (clay, tools, and aprons)
  • Instruction by our skilled pottery teachers
  • Glazing and firing of your finished piece (ready for pickup within 2-3 weeks)
How much does the workshop cost?

The cost varies depending on the type of workshop and group size. Please check our website or contact us directly for the most up-to-date pricing.

Can I take my pottery home the same day?

Unfortunately, no. Your pottery will need to be dried, glazed, and fired, which takes about 2-3 weeks. Once ready, we’ll notify you to pick it up.

What should I wear?

Wear comfortable clothes that you don’t mind getting a little messy. We provide aprons, but pottery can be a hands-on (and sometimes muddy) experience. Closed-toe shoes are recommended.
